By doing so, the need to tie plants to a stake or something is drastically reduced. ---------- A bit of a lecture, I'm afraid: Another way to promote strong stems is the addition of blue and violet wavelenghts. Plants grown under MH are significantly shorter and stronger (which translates into tighter buds) than those grown under HPS, although the dry weight is generally equitable. Also, MH produces superior quality chemicals compared to HPS. Growers may argue this, but I'm speaking from quite a bit of experience with single-plant clones grown in seperate lighting enviroments, as well as from some formal trainning (and alot of informal as well!) in organic Chemistry. THC is a high energy cannabinoid. It's percursors, i.e. CBD, is a lower energy cannabiniod, as are it's breakdown products (Like CBN, if I recall correctly). Likewise, light toward the violet end of the spectrum is higher in energy content than light toward the red. What this means is that it takes more red light, be it measured in watts, wavelenghts, or "individual" photons, to "upgrade" the abundantly occuring CBD into THC (remember, the plant has no inherent need for THC, as the other, "cheaper" in energy content, cannabinods present handle the job quite well). This is the reason natural populations of cannabis tend toward higher THC content as one approaches the equator and/or higher altitudes. The blues are more pronounced in those places, because the atomophere is thinner. In practice, mixing MH/HPS in a wattage ration of not less than 60/40 has proven highly desirable. But if I could choose only one or the other, I'd break with the tradionalist and take MH without a second thought.

I've been growing pot indoors for 15 years. I invested $1,000.00 about 10 years ago for a complete CO2 augmentation system. Which now sits in my garage, gathering dust. Because I discovered that excellent ventilation is almost as good as augmentating with CO2, and cheaper and less hassle. Increased levels of CO2 help during lights on during veg and the first 3 weeks of flowering, when the plant is growing (in height). After that, the plant changes. The plant is no longer growing per se; it is making buds. I was luckly enough to be able to run multiple grow chambers a few years back, and did side-by-side comparisons. The rate of bud production, and the final yield showed me that CO2 doesn't help during bud formation. Plants also need nute's during veg and most of flowering. But many growers flush their plants during the last 2 weeks of flowering, using just plain water--yet bud/trich production continue's. To adequately utilize CO2 augmentation, you need to know how much CO2 is present (the last time I checked atmospheric ppm meters cost $500.00) and you also need a way to regulate the amt. it's getting--too much is just as 'bad' as too little. What CO2 does is speed up growth during veg. If you are growing to a certain height before switching to flowering, using CO2 will get you to that height quicker--approx 10% quicker than flo-thro ventilation. But it won't speed up the time needed for bud production/ripeness, nor will it make for bigger, or more stonier buds in the final yield.
